Output 3fa91ffcbaee114d87c6f03f4f90ea0b755693c5fac7cc3399a8164e9ccae0f8:20

value
849850
script pubkey
OP_0 OP_PUSHBYTES_20 14f7638d4aee04468b3bc082cbb3d2b93341042a
address
bc1qznmk8r22aczydzemczpvhv7jhye5zpp2l36al2
transaction
3fa91ffcbaee114d87c6f03f4f90ea0b755693c5fac7cc3399a8164e9ccae0f8
confirmations
167249
spent
true